On Fri, 2006-02-03 at 13:40 +0100, Martin Jeppesen wrote: > Thanks for yet another version of Rhythmbox =) > > Here are some thoughts: > > * I love that "Edit->Delete" have been replaced with "Edit->Move to > trash". But I think it is rather dangerous that the shortcut is CTRL+T > and SHIFT+CTRL+T is toolbar on/off. I would suggest "Move to trash" > should be CTRL+Delete or perhaps ALT+Delete
I'm not sure that toolbar on/off should even have a shortcut - I can't imagine people using it that often. We're using Ctrl-T for Move to Trash, because that's what Nautilus uses; if we get rid on Ctrl-Shift-T as a shortcut, keeping that is good. > * According to the HIG should there be 12 pixels around the contents > of a window. > http://developer.gnome.org/projects/gup/hig/2.0/design-window.html > > I think this was once implanted in a 0.9.x version. Have it been > removed on purpose? I think it must have disappeared when the toolbar-related UI changes got added. > Would it be a good idea to rename Edit->Preferences->General to > Edit->Preferences->Browser ? Makes sense.
